@charset "utf-8";
/* CSS Document */

@font-face {font-family:'Verdana'; src:url('../fonts/Verdana.ttf') format('truetype');}

body{ width:1300px; margin:0px auto; padding:0px; font-family:"Verdana"; }
a{ text-decoration:none;}ul{margin: 0px;padding:0px; list-style: none;}

.background{ width:1300px; height:704px; margin:0 auto; padding:0px; background:url(../images/background.jpg) no-repeat; }

.main-div{ width:100%; margin:0px; padding:0px; margin-top:-690px;}
.main{ width:100%; margin:0px auto; padding:0px;}

.wrapper{ width:1050px; margin:0px auto;}
.wrapper1{ width:1050px; margin:0px auto; overflow:hidden; padding-bottom:10px;}
.wrapper2{ width:1050px; height:47px; margin:0px auto; background-image:url(../images/mbg.jpg);}
.wrapper-left{ width:100%; margin:0px; padding:0px; margin-top:190px; background:url(../images/bg-left.jpg) left repeat-y;}
.wrapper-right{ width:100%; margin:0px; padding:0px; background:url(../images/bg-right.jpg) right repeat-y;}


#logo{ width:144px; float:left; margin-left:30px;}
#con{ width:380px; float:right; padding-right:50px;}
#con p{ margin:0px; color:#fcfafa; font-size:15px; font-weight:bold; line-height:24px;}
#con p span{ width:150px; float:right;}

#nav{ width:720px; margin:0px; padding-top:14px; margin-left:50px; z-index:9999;}
#nav li { float:left; position: relative; margin:0px; z-index:9999;}
#nav li a{ padding: 15px 20px; color:#ffffff; font-size:15px;}
#nav li a:hover{color:#ffffff; background-image:url(../images/mbg2.jpg);} 
#nav li:hover > ul {display:block; visibility: visible;}
#nav ul { display: none; position: absolute; visibility: hidden; top: 32px; left: 0;}
#nav ul li a { display:block; width: 280px; padding: 6px 8px; color:#000; font-size:14px; background: #ffffff;}
#nav ul li a:hover { background: #0779f3; color:#ffffff }


#content{ width:100%; margin:0px; float:right; z-index:1; margin-top:-170px;}

	
#content{
	background: rgba(255,255,255,1);
background: -moz-linear-gradient(top, rgba(255,255,255,0) 0%, rgba(255,255,255,0.8) 30%, rgba(255,255,255,0.8) 50%, rgba(255,255,255,0.84) 66%, rgba(255,255,255,0.99) 80%, rgba(255,255,255,1) 100%);
background: -webkit-linear-gradient(top, rgba(255,255,255,0) 0%, rgba(255,255,255,0.8) 30%, rgba(255,255,255,0.8) 50%, rgba(255,255,255,0.84) 66%, rgba(255,255,255,0.99) 80%, rgba(255,255,255,1) 100%);
background: -o-linear-gradient(top, rgba(255,255,255,0) 0%, rgba(255,255,255,0.8) 30%, rgba(255,255,255,0.8) 50%, rgba(255,255,255,0.84) 66%, rgba(255,255,255,0.99) 80%, rgba(255,255,255,1) 100%);
background: -ms-linear-gradient(top, rgba(255,255,255,0) 0%, rgba(255,255,255,0.8) 30%, rgba(255,255,255,0.8) 50%, rgba(255,255,255,0.84) 66%, rgba(255,255,255,0.99) 80%, rgba(255,255,255,1) 100%);
fil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#ffffff', endColorstr='#ffffff', GradientType=0 );
	}
#colm-l{ width:800px; float:left; margin:0px; margin-left:20px;}
#colm-l h2{ color:#000000; font-size:22px; margin:0px; padding:5px 0px;}
#colm-l p{ color:#000000; margin:0px; padding:5px 0px; font-size:14px; line-height:22px; text-align:justify;}
#colm-r{ width:214px; float:right; margin:0px;}
#gall{ width:214px; height:198px; background:url(../images/gallery.png) no-repeat; padding-top:70px;}
#images-wrapper {width: 190px; height: 120px; margin:0px auto;}
#images img{ padding:15px 0px;}
#msg{ width:212px; height:325px; overflow:hidden; background:url(../images/msg.png) no-repeat; padding-top:30px;}
#msg p{ margin:0px 15px; padding:10px 0px; border-bottom:1px solid #0fbad8; font-size:15px; text-align:justify;}
#msg p a{ color:#ffffff;}

#col-center{ width:100%; margin:0px auto; background:#ffffff; padding-top:100px;}

#cont{ width:98%; margin:0px; float:right; margin-right:5px; overflow:hidden;}
#colm-1{ width:350px; float:left; margin-right:15px;}
#colm-2{ width:420px; float:left; margin-right:15px; padding-bottom:10px;}
#colm-2 h3{ margin:0px; padding:5px 0px; color:#000000; font-size:20px;}
#colm-3{ width:210px; float:right; background:#000000; border-radius:10px; padding:30px 0px;}
#colm-3 h3{ width:95%; margin:0px; padding:0px 0px 5px 5px; color:#ffffff; font-size:20px;}

/*----------Enquiry form-------------*/
#enq {width:100%; padding:0px;margin:0px; border:0px; }
#enq td{ padding-bottom:4px;}
#enq .txtbox,#enq .txtboxa{width:96%; padding:5px 4px; color:#ffffff; font-size:13px; border:1px solid #515151; background:#202020;}
.txtbox:focus,.txtboxa:focus{outline:none;}
.sbtn{ width:70px; float:right; background:#497601; color:#ffffff; font-size:13px; padding:4px 0px; border:0px; border-radius:15px; cursor:pointer;}
.sbtn:focus{outline:none; border:none; }

#line1{ width:33%; height:3px; float:left; background:#abaf24;}
#line2{ width:33%; height:3px; float:left; background:#b32c18;}
#line3{ width:33%; height:3px; float:left; background:#206c6c;}
#line4{ width:47.8%; height:3px; float:left; margin-top:10px; background:#fa0606;}
#cir{ width:47px; height:47px; float:left; margin:-12px -3px 0px -3px;}

#product{ width:95%; margin:0px auto; overflow:hidden;}
#prod{ width:225px; float:left; margin:0px 16px 20px 16px;}
#prod h3{ color:#2d4be3; margin:0px; padding:10px 0px; font-size:20px; text-align:center;}
#prod p{ color:#000000; font-size:14px; margin:0px; padding:5px 0px; text-align:justify; line-height:22px;}
#prod a{ float:right; outline:none;}

#time{ width:95%; margin:0px auto; overflow:hidden;}
#clock{ width:124px; float:left; margin:0px 20px 15px 20px;}
#clock p{ color:#000000; font-size:13px; text-align:center; margin:0px; padding:5px 0px;}

#pro-img{ width:95%; margin:0px auto; overflow:hidden; padding:5px 0px 15px 0px;}
#pro-img img{ margin:0px 15px;} 

#footer{ width:100%; margin:0px; overflow:hidden; background:#1a47bf;}
#left{ margin:0px 5px; padding:10px 0px; float:left; color:#ffffff; font-size:14px;}
#right{ margin:0px 5px; padding:10px 0px; float:right; color:#ffffff; font-size:14px;}#right a{ color:#ffffff;}

#col-left{ width:420px; float:left; margin:0px; padding:0px 20px 20px 20px;}
#col-left p{ margin:0px; padding:3px 0px; color:#000000; font-size:14px; line-height:22px;}
#col-left p b{ font-size:22px;}
#col-left h3{ color:#4A4A4A; font-size:22px; text-align:center;}
#col-right{ width:550px; float:left; margin:0px;}



/*----------Enquiry form-------------*/
#qenq {width:80%; padding:0px;margin:0px auto; border:0px; }
#qenq td #td-l{ width:50%; padding-bottom:4px; color:#232323; font-size:15px;}
#qenq td #td-r{ width:100%; float:left; padding-bottom:4px;}
.txtbox,.txtboxa{width:98%; padding:5px 4px; color:#797777; font-size:14px; border:1px solid #8A8A8A; border-radius:5px; background:#202020;}
.txtbox:focus,.txtboxa:focus{outline:none;}
#btn{ width:80px; margin:0px auto; overflow:hidden;}
.sbtn{ width:80px; margin:0 auto; background: rgba(75,94,124,1); color:#ffffff; font-size:15px; padding:6px 0px; border:0px; border-radius:5px; cursor:pointer;}
.sbtn{background: rgba(11,13,15,0.84);
background: linear-gradient(to bottom, rgba(11,13,15,0.84) 0%, rgba(9,9,10,0.85) 2%, rgba(75,94,124,0.86) 6%, rgba(75,94,124,0.92) 27%, rgba(75,94,124,0.92) 28%, rgba(75,94,124,0.65) 62%, rgba(75,94,124,0.79) 92%, rgba(11,13,15,0.83) 100%);
fil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#0b0d0f', endColorstr='#0b0d0f', GradientType=0 );}

.sbtn:focus{outline:none; border:none; }
.ermsg{ color:#FF0F0F; font-size:14px; line-height:22px;}

#vimg{width:80px; height:35px; float:left; margin-right:10px;}
#captcha{width:150px; float:left;}


/* Pagination */

.pg-normal { 
color: #000000; 
font-size: 15px; 
cursor: pointer; 

padding: 2px 4px 2px 4px; 
}

.pg-selected { 
color: #fff; 
font-size: 15px; 
background: #000000; 
padding: 2px 4px 2px 4px; 
}

table.yui { 
font-family:arial; 
border-collapse:collapse; 
width:100%;
float:left; 
}

table.yui td { 
padding: 5px; 
}

table.yui th { 
border: 1px solid #7f7f7f; 
padding: 5px; 
height: auto; 
background: #D0B389; 
}

table.yui th a { 
text-decoration: none; 
text-align: center; 
padding-right: 20px; 
font-weight:bold; 
white-space:nowrap; 
}

table.yui tfoot td { 
border-top: 1px solid #7f7f7f; 
background-color:#E1ECF9; 
}

table.yui thead td { 
vertical-align:middle; 
background-color:#E1ECF9; 
border:none; 
}

table.yui thead .tableHeader { 
font-size:larger; 
font-weight:bold; 
}

table.yui thead .filter { 
text-align:right; 
}

table.yui tfoot { 
background-color:#E1ECF9; 
text-align:center; 
}

table.yui .tablesorterPager { 
padding: 10px 0 10px 0; 
}

table.yui .tablesorterPager span { 
padding: 0 5px 0 5px; 
}

table.yui .tablesorterPager input.prev { 
width: auto; 
margin-right: 10px; 
}

table.yui .tablesorterPager input.next { 
width: auto; 
margin-left: 10px; 
}

table.yui .pagedisplay { 
font-size:10pt; 
width: 30px; 
border: 0px; 
background-color: #E1ECF9; 
text-align:center; 
vertical-align:top; 
}

/* Pagination */
.gallery{ width:90%; margin:0px auto; overflow:hidden; padding:0px; padding-bottom:15px;}
#gallery-1{width:100%; float:left; padding:0px 0px 10px 0px;}
#gallery-1 h1{ text-align:center; font-weight:normal; font-size:22px; color:#575555;}
#gallery-1a{width:192px; height:131px; float:left; margin:8px 20px 8px 20px;}

#pagn{width:100%;float:left;}
#pagn1{width:100%;float:left;padding:0px 0px 0px 0px;}
#pagn2{width:100%;float:left; padding:0px 0px 0px 0px;}
#pageNavPosition1 h1{ text-align:center; color:#000000; font-size:20px; margin:0px; padding:5px 0px;}
#pageNavPosition{float:right;}

